Masonry work is an essential aspect of construction that involves the use of various materials to create durable structures. One of the key components in masonry is masonry cement, which plays a crucial role in binding bricks, stones, and blocks together. masonry cement (砂浆水泥) is specifically formulated to provide excellent adhesion and strength, making it ideal for both structural and non-structural applications. This type of cement is designed to withstand the rigors of weather and time, ensuring that the structures built with it remain intact and functional for many years.The composition of masonry cement typically includes a mixture of Portland cement, sand, and other additives that enhance its performance. The Portland cement serves as the primary binder, while the sand provides bulk and stability. Additional ingredients may be included to improve workability, water retention, and resistance to environmental factors such as moisture and freeze-thaw cycles. By understanding the properties and benefits of masonry cement, builders can make informed decisions about the materials they use in their projects.One of the significant advantages of using masonry cement is its versatility. It can be used in a variety of applications, from constructing walls and foundations to creating decorative elements like patios and walkways. The flexibility of masonry cement allows it to be utilized in both residential and commercial projects, making it a favorite among contractors and architects alike. Furthermore, masonry cement can be colored or textured to achieve different aesthetic effects, providing additional creative options for designers.In addition to its practical applications, masonry cement also contributes to the overall sustainability of construction projects. Many manufacturers produce masonry cement using recycled materials, which helps reduce waste and lower the carbon footprint of building activities. This environmentally friendly approach aligns with the growing trend of sustainable construction, where minimizing environmental impact is a top priority.When working with masonry cement, it is essential to follow best practices to ensure optimal results. Proper mixing is crucial; the right proportions of cement, sand, and water must be maintained to achieve the desired consistency and strength. Additionally, the application technique can significantly affect the performance of masonry cement. For instance, ensuring that surfaces are clean and adequately prepared before applying the cement can lead to better adhesion and durability.Moreover, curing is a vital step in the masonry process when using masonry cement. Curing involves maintaining adequate moisture levels during the initial hardening phase to prevent cracking and ensure the strength of the final product. This process may involve covering the masonry work with wet burlap or plastic sheeting to retain moisture, especially in hot or dry conditions.In conclusion, masonry cement (砂浆水泥) is a fundamental material in the field of construction that offers numerous benefits, including strength, versatility, and sustainability. Its ability to bond various masonry units makes it indispensable for building sturdy and lasting structures. As the construction industry continues to evolve, the importance of understanding and utilizing masonry cement effectively cannot be overstated. By leveraging its properties and adhering to best practices, builders can ensure that their projects stand the test of time, contributing to a more resilient built environment.
